Dustin Dominguez To Race AMA Supermoto

After an unfortunate split between Dustin Dominguez and his road race team in the MotoAmerica series, Dustin has started an AMA Supermoto team. Racing is a lifestyle for Dustin, and although he hopes to continue racing the MotoAmerica series in the future he won’t sit around and collect dust in the meantime. The decision to race AMA Supermoto is an easy one for Dominguez as he has been training on supermoto bikes for years.

“I’m excited to start the next chapter in my career. I have always loved supermoto and feel like it’s a good place for me to start something new. I am excited to have fun on a bike again and can’t thank my sponsors enough for sticking by my side,” says Dominguez.

Dominguez plans to race the remaining rounds of AMA Supermoto starting in Denver, Colorado, July 3rd and 4th. For more information and sponsorship opportunities please contact Dustin at [email protected]
